Cultural References


Let's dive into a classic example: The late-night TV show "Saturday Night Live." Its irreverent approach to politics, pop culture, and societal norms has left a lasting impact on American humor. Similarly, British sketch comedy shows like "Monty Python" continue to influence global humor, blending surrealism and satire to provoke and entertain audiences worldwide.
